body{

   background-color: #086DB5;

	background-image: url(images/mainbg.gif);

   margin: 0 0 0 0;

	background-repeat: repeat-x;

	background-position: top;

}

table{

border:0px; 

border-collapse: collapse; 

COLOR: #3E3939; FONT-FAMILY: Lucida Sans, Tahoma, Verdana, Arial; FONT-SIZE: 11px;

	line-height: 14px;

}

table td{

padding:0px; 

COLOR: #3E3939; FONT-FAMILY: Lucida Sans, Tahoma, Verdana, Arial; FONT-SIZE: 11px

}

img {

	 border:  0px;

}

img.text {

	float: left;

	margin-right: 10px;

}

input.search {

	width:130px; 

	height:19px; 

	BORDER-BOTTOM: #B6C2CD 1px solid; 

	BORDER-LEFT: #B6C2CD 1px solid; 

	BORDER-RIGHT: #B6C2CD 1px solid; 

	BORDER-TOP: #B6C2CD 1px solid; 

	font-family: Lucida Sans, Tahoma; 

	font-size:11px; 

	color:#3E3939;

}

option.head {

	background-color: #EFEFEF;

}

table.top {

	background-color: #194997;

	width:763px;

	height:77px;

}

table.menu {

		width:763px;

	height:27px; 

	background-color: #D9D9CF; 

	background-image: url(images/menubg.gif);

}

table.menuContent {

	border-collapse: separate; 

}

table.menuContent td{

	padding: 2px;

}

table.flash {

	 	width:763px;

	height:68px; 

	background-color: #86A6C5;

}

table.bar {

	height:25px; 

	background-color: #DDDDDD;

	background-image: url(images/upcontentfield.gif);

}

td.main2 {

	padding: 10px;

	background-color: #F4F4F4;

	vertical-align: top;

	width: 370px;

}

td.main {

	padding: 10px;

	background-color: #F4F4F4;

	vertical-align: top;

	width: 530px;

}

td.main3 {

	padding: 10px;

	background-color: #F4F4F4;

	vertical-align: top;

	width: 600px;

}

td.right {

	background-color: #ECECEC;

	vertical-align: top;

	width: 200px;

}

td.right2 {

	background-color: #ECECEC;

	vertical-align: top;

	width: 200px;

	padding: 13px;

}

td.left {

	background-color: #ECECEC;

	vertical-align: top;

	text-align: center;

	width: 135px;

}

td.left table{

		border-collapse: separate; 

}

table.t {

	border: 1px solid #ffffff;

}

table.t td{

	vertical-align: middle;

	text-align: center;

	padding: 2px;	border: 1px solid #ffffff;

}

table.t td#head{

	vertical-align: middle;

	text-align: left;

	padding: 2px;	border: 1px solid #ffffff;

}

A:link {

	COLOR: #559BDE; FONT-FAMILY: Lucida Sans, Tahoma, Verdana, Arial; FONT-SIZE: 11px; TEXT-DECORATION: underline

}

A:visited {

	COLOR: #559BDE; FONT-FAMILY: Lucida Sans, Tahoma, Verdana, Arial; FONT-SIZE: 11px; TEXT-DECORATION: underline

}

A:active {

	COLOR: #559BDE; FONT-FAMILY: Lucida Sans, Tahoma, Verdana, Arial; FONT-SIZE: 11px; TEXT-DECORATION: underline

}

A:hover {

	COLOR: #559BDE; FONT-FAMILY: Lucida Sans, Tahoma, Verdana, Arial; FONT-SIZE: 11px; TEXT-DECORATION: none

}



A.menu:link {

	COLOR: #191919; FONT-FAMILY: Lucida Sans, Tahoma, Verdana, Arial; FONT-SIZE: 11px; TEXT-DECORATION: none

}

A.menu:visited {

	COLOR: #191919; FONT-FAMILY: Lucida Sans, Tahoma, Verdana, Arial; FONT-SIZE: 11px; TEXT-DECORATION: none

}

A.menu:active {

	COLOR: #191919; FONT-FAMILY: Lucida Sans, Tahoma, Verdana, Arial; FONT-SIZE: 11px; TEXT-DECORATION: none

}

A.menu:hover {

	COLOR: #559BDE; FONT-FAMILY: Lucida Sans, Tahoma, Verdana, Arial; FONT-SIZE: 11px; TEXT-DECORATION: none

}



.header {

	COLOR: #65AEEB; FONT-FAMILY: Lucida Sans, Tahoma, Verdana, Arial; FONT-SIZE: 11px; TEXT-DECORATION: none; FONT-WEIGHT: bold

}



A.header:link {

	COLOR: #65AEEB; FONT-FAMILY: Lucida Sans, Tahoma, Verdana, Arial; FONT-SIZE: 11px; TEXT-DECORATION: none; FONT-WEIGHT: bold

}

A.header:visited {

	COLOR: #65AEEB; FONT-FAMILY: Lucida Sans, Tahoma, Verdana, Arial; FONT-SIZE: 11px; TEXT-DECORATION: none; FONT-WEIGHT: bold

}

A.header:active {

	COLOR: #65AEEB; FONT-FAMILY: Lucida Sans, Tahoma, Verdana, Arial; FONT-SIZE: 11px; TEXT-DECORATION: none; FONT-WEIGHT: bold

}

A.header:hover {

	COLOR: #65AEEB; FONT-FAMILY: Lucida Sans, Tahoma, Verdana, Arial; FONT-SIZE: 11px; TEXT-DECORATION: none; FONT-WEIGHT: bold

}



.white {

	COLOR: #FFFFFF; FONT-FAMILY: Lucida Sans, Tahoma, Verdana, Arial; FONT-SIZE: 11px; TEXT-DECORATION: none

}



A.white:link {

	COLOR: #FFFFFF; FONT-FAMILY: Lucida Sans, Tahoma, Verdana, Arial; FONT-SIZE: 11px; TEXT-DECORATION: underline

}

A.white:visited {

	COLOR: #FFFFFF; FONT-FAMILY: Lucida Sans, Tahoma, Verdana, Arial; FONT-SIZE: 11px; TEXT-DECORATION: underline

}

A.white:active {

	COLOR: #FFFFFF; FONT-FAMILY: Lucida Sans, Tahoma, Verdana, Arial; FONT-SIZE: 11px; TEXT-DECORATION: underline

}

A.white:hover {

	COLOR: #FFFFFF; FONT-FAMILY: Lucida Sans, Tahoma, Verdana, Arial; FONT-SIZE: 11px; TEXT-DECORATION: none

}

select {

	width:160px; height:19px; font-family: Lucida Sans, Tahoma; font-size:11px; color: #3E3939;

}

p.customer {

	padding: 13px;

}

p.leftMenu {

	padding: 7px;

}

input.text {

	width:200px; 

	height:19px; 

	BORDER-BOTTOM: #C7C7C7 1px solid; 

	BORDER-LEFT: #C7C7C7 1px solid; 

	BORDER-RIGHT: #C7C7C7 1px solid; 

	BORDER-TOP: #C7C7C7 1px solid; 

	font-family:Tahoma; 

	font-size:11px; 

	font-color:#242424;

}

textarea {

	width:200px; height:80px; font-family:Tahoma; font-size:11px; font-color:#242424;

}

select{

	width:160px; height:19px; font-family: Lucida Sans, Tahoma; font-size:11px; font-color:#3E3939;

}

input.submit {

	width:80px; height:21px; font-family:Tahoma; font-size:11px; font-color:#242424;

}



.date {

	COLOR: #020202; FONT-FAMILY: Lucida Sans, Tahoma, Verdana, Arial; FONT-SIZE: 11px; PADDING: 1px; BACKGROUND-COLOR: #EAEAEA; TEXT-DECORATION: none

}



/* index page */

table.puzzle td { vertical-align: top; text-align: justify; width: 50%; }
